Morgan Stanley Cuts Microchip Technology (NASDAQ:MCHP) Price Target to $58.00

Microchip Technology (NASDAQ:MCHPFree Report) had its price target trimmed by Morgan Stanley from $71.00 to $58.00 in a report issued on Tuesday morning,Benzinga reports. The brokerage currently has an equal weight rating on the semiconductor company’s stock.

MCHP has been the subject of a number of other research reports. Bank of America lowered shares of Microchip Technology from a “neutral” rating to an “underperform” rating and cut their price objective for the company from $80.00 to $65.00 in a research report on Monday, December 16th. B. Riley cut their price target on Microchip Technology from $93.00 to $85.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Friday, January 24th. Rosenblatt Securities restated a “buy” rating and set a $90.00 price objective on shares of Microchip Technology in a report on Wednesday, November 6th. Citigroup dropped their target price on Microchip Technology from $92.00 to $82.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, November 6th. Finally, StockNews.com raised Microchip Technology from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Friday, December 13th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, five have given a hold rating and thirteen have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, Microchip Technology has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$81.67.

Microchip Technology Trading Down 0.7 %

Shares of Microchip Technology stock opened at $53.11 on Tuesday. Microchip Technology has a 1 year low of $51.37 and a 1 year high of $100.57.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.71, a current ratio of 0.88 and a quick ratio of 0.48.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$58.34 and a 200 day moving average price of $70.38. The company has a market capitalization of $28.52 billion, a P/E ratio of 37.14 and a beta of 1.50.

Microchip Technology (NASDAQ:MCHPG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 6th. The semiconductor company reported $0.13 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.28 by ($0.15). Microchip Technology had a net margin of 14.22% and a return on equity of 19.47%.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Microchip Technology will post 1.31 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Microchip Technology Announces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, March 7th. Investors of record on Monday, February 24th will be issued a dividend of $0.455 per share. This represents a $1.82 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.43%. Microchip Technology’s payout ratio is currently 127.27%.

Microchip Technology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Microchip Technology Incorporated engages in the development, manufacture, and sale of smart, connected, and secure embedded control solutions in the Americas, Europe, and Asia. The company offers general purpose 8-bit, 16-bit, and 32-bit mixed-signal microcontrollers; 32-bit embedded mixed-signal microprocessors; and specialized microcontrollers for automotive, industrial, computing, communications, lighting, power supplies, motor control, human machine interface, security, wired connectivity, and wireless connectivity applications.
